What Is The Most Up To Date Adobe Photoshop Elements 2020 Version?

Explorer ,
Jan 27, 2020 Jan 27, 2020

Copy link to clipboard

Copied

Is this the most up to date Adobe Photoshop Elements 2020 version? 

18.0 (20190827.m.136736)

 

Where do I look to find out, next time?

I had a question about Updates and was informed that v18.0 (20190827.m.136736) IS current if you have a Windows PC. There was an update on Jan 13 that was sent to all (Windows & Mac) but was only intended for macOS. It was later rescinded for Windows PCs. That update was v18.0 (20200105.m.139301) but only applied to macOS.

 

If there is an update available, the Help>Updates... menu item becomes active and you will be automatically updated or notified depending on your setting in Preferences.

Hi John.  I just successfully updated on Windows (even though I had updated with the January 13th 2020.1 update).

 

The odd thing about how the latest updates have been employed is that you are given a choice to update "now" or "upon exit."  However, if you choose "now", the update interrupts until Elements is closed.  I think the updater automatically closes the Organizer but not the Home Screen.
